member
Définition technique
- Origine : RFC4519 (groupOfNames)
- Nom : member
- Description : désigne les membres d'un groupe
- OID : 2.5.4.31
- Attribut parent : distinguishedName (attribut prototype)
- Valuation : mutivalué
- ObjectClass : groupOfNames
- Obligatoire : oui
- Type de donnée : DN (Distinguished Name)
- Règles de comparaison : égalité
Règles d'exploitation
- Type d'usage: technique
- Contexte d'utilisation : LDAP
- Visibilité : privé
- Indexation recommandée : eq
Utilisation
Chaque valeur de cet attribut contient un DN vers un objet membre du groupe.
Remarque: l'absence de membres PEUT être matérialisée par la présence d'une seule valeur contenant le DN nul (chaîne vide).
Exemples
Valuation
Groupe de 2 personnes :
dn: cn=applications.apogee.users,ou=groups,dc=univ-exemple,dc=fr objectClass: groupOfNames member: uid=jdupont,ou=people,dc=univ-exemple,dc=fr member: uid=cdurand,ou=people,dc=univ-exemple,dc=fr
Groupe de 3 applications, leur donnant accès au supannEtuId :
dn: cn=acl.attr.supannEtuId.read,ou=applicationGroups,dc=univ-exemple,dc=fr objectClass: groupOfNames member: cn=snw,ou=applications,dc=univ-exemple,dc=fr member: cn=apogee,ou=applications,dc=univ-exemple,dc=fr member: cn=reseaupro,ou=applications,dc=univ-exemple,dc=fr
Groupe vide :
dn: cn=collab.projetbu,ou=groups,dc=univ-exemple,dc=fr objectClass: groupOfNames member:
Filtrage
Recherche des groupes dont un utilisateur est membre:
(&(objectClass=groupOfNames)(member=uid=jdupont,ou=users,dc=univ-exemple,dc=fr))